Creamy baby lima bean and yukon gold potato soup with Kerrygold cheddar grilled cheese.
Fragrant rosemary and roasted garlic add to the rich creaminess of this meal.
Start by soaking the beans overnight.
Pour out the water and add fresh water for quick boiling.
When you’ve brought these beans to a boil pour out this water, as well.
For the final cooking add enough water to cover plus about 4 cups.
Add a large sweet onion and allow to cook until the onion is soft and translucent.
Meanwhile, roast a head of garlic in the oven at 350 degrees for about 30 minutes
When the onion is done remove and place in the food processer with the roasted garlic, about 2 Tbspn of dried rosemary, 1/4 cup of olive oil and 2 Tbspn flour.
Blend until creamy.
Add this to the boiling beans.
Add 2 Tbspn of vegetarian boullion and salt and pepper to taste.
Chop 5-6 Yukon Gold potatoes and ad to the soup and allow to cook on medium heat for 2 hours.
